Can you use hate to make the world a better place?
Daryl Davis, a world-class jazz musician, didn’t just confront hate—he dismantled it. By sitting down with over 200 Ku Klux Klan members, he inspired them to leave their robes behind. But this isn’t just a story about racism or redemption; it’s a story about the incredible power of human connection and the lessons it holds for all of us.
In this special episode, Dave explores how Daryl turned impossible conversations into transformative breakthroughs. Together, they unpack the mindset shifts, emotional intelligence, and fearless curiosity that can break down barriers of all kinds—whether they’re rooted in bias, fear, or misunderstanding.
Daryl’s approach to erasing hate is so unique, so impactful, that it may just change how you view conflict, compassion, and even your own health.
